Changes in Element 1.1.3 (2021-03-18)
===================================================
Features ✨:
-
Bugfix 🐛:
- Fix regression in UpdateTrustWorker (introduced in 1.1.2)
- Timeline : Fix ripple effect on text item and fix background color of separators.
Changes in Element 1.1.2 (2021-03-16) (was not published tp GPlay prod)
===================================================
Improvements 🙌:
- Lazy storage of ReadReceipts
- Do not load room members in e2e after init sync
Bugfix 🐛:
- Add option to cancel stuck messages at bottom of timeline see #516
- Ensure message are decrypted in the room list after a clear cache
- Regression: Video will not play upon tap, but only after swipe #2928
- Cross signing now works with servers with an explicit port in the servername
Other changes:
- Change formatting on issue templates to proper headings.
